Vendor note: FeedTrue Labs supplies the Castwell podcast feed validator we embed in our ingestion pipeline. Their library parses untrusted XML, so review their quarterly security attestation before each upgrade, and confirm the entity-expansion limits remain enforced in our build config. FeedTrue has agreed to 48-hour disclosure on vulnerabilities. For attestation copies or disclosure questions, reach their security desk here.

escalation mailbox, bafog-fafog: ulador@paliqlabs.internal

FAQ: What if I'm locked out of the Hueledger audit workspace?

Contractors running the color-contrast audit for the Marrowgate redesign sometimes lose access after the weekly permission sweep. Don't create a new account; that breaks audit attribution. Instead, open the Hueledger recovery prompt, confirm your assigned component list, and enter the team passphrase printed directly beneath this answer.

unlock words, bagug-kadup: wenath-zorael

### Restarting spool-relay

If the Pemberton print jobs stall, restart the spool-relay service on the Quillhaven node. Check that the retry counter resets to zero in the logs. The service reads its job table from the Darnell database on startup, so confirm the table is reachable first. Use the connection string below when testing connectivity.

primary connection of yagep-kahip = redis://giliel_svc:zYiKsLL2PLpfPL@db-348f.xolmarsys.corp:5432/fenwyn

TICKET #—Missed Pick-up, Trial Plot Seeds

Courier from Bramwick Express failed to collect the seed samples for the Ostervale trial plot yesterday. Samples remain sealed in cold room B. Re-pickup scheduled tomorrow morning. Receiving site: hold planting schedule one day. Verify seal integrity before release. Hand-over instruction for the courier is below:

handover note for yagef-bagep: the drudor pelius courier leaves the kasdor zorvan norir ledger at gate 8016 under passcode 755406